Commission Structure Do This Get This Here’s Your Total So Far Attend and sign in at council/district popcorn kickoff training Submit your Take Order unit order and return any unneeded Show N Sell product by the week of October 27 Add 2% commission32% Sell one bag of popcornAdd 1% commission 33% Reach $2,500 in salesAdd 1% commission 34% Reach $5,000 in sales Add 1% commission35% Reach $7,500 in sales Add 2% commission37% Have a 5% increase over your 2013 sale Add 3% commission40% There are two ways to reach 40% Commission!! Method One: Reach $10,000 in sales, attend a training and meet your deadlines. Your Unit receives a 40% commission automatically! Method Two: Start with your Base Commission of 30% and add to it. These commissions are cumulative – earn as many as you can.

Why are goals important? Key to success – in scouting and in life Give us clear direction Drive us forward Make us accountable – to ourselves and others In scouting: Advance in rank Complete service projects Earn belt loops Learn skills The Importance of Goal-Setting

And in popcorn: Scouts who set goals: Average sale of $626 Scouts with no goal: Average sale of $304 Units that set sales goals sell twice as much as units without goals Only 44% of parents said their sons set sales goals Encourage goals! Set and publicize the Unit Goal Help scouts set individual goals (dollars/prizes, # customers, # hours, # houses/asks) The Importance of Goal-Setting

Scout Training & Sales Incentives Review sales methods, instructions and techniques Always wear your Class A Uniform. Always sell with an adult and/or with a group. Never enter anyone’s home. Do not sell after dark. Always stay on the sidewalks and driveways. Collect money when taking orders. Never carry large amounts of cash. Let the scouts share tips and best practices Train parents, too! It’s about the scouts: support them to be successful Order forms at work: best with a scout! Online selling

Show & Sell Orders & Returns Initial Orders: Units with a prior sales history may order 10% over last year’s actual Show and Sell product sales. Units with no prior sales history may order based on $100 of product per registered Scout selling. Additional products will be available for sale in the event the unit runs short or out of product. Units may return Show and Sell popcorn prior to November 2 to the Council Service Center for redistribution to other units. Chocolate Products are not returnable. All returns to the office must be scheduled in advance. The Bucks County Council reserves the right to adjust unit orders as needed.

Best Practices: Take Order Sales Collect money up front so you can deliver if people aren’t home. Coordinate scouts in neighborhoods and among units. Reassign neighborhoods to scouts if their neighborhoods aren’t good for selling.

Best Practices: Show & Sells Stick to 2 scouts per shift. You don’t make much more money with more scouts and so they each receive less credit for the time. Leave No Trace: leave it better than you found it You can split Cheese Lovers and Sweet & Savory Collections When scheduling, ask the manager if any other scout groups are scheduled and if they are, check with that troop/pack to make sure you are not double-booked.
